PETERSFIELD].—LECTURE.—On Tuesday evening, the 4th inst., an interesting and instructive lecture was given in the Petersfield British school, in the College-street, subject ‟Columbus, and the discovery of the New World.” The lecturer, Mr. Jackson, went deeply into the subject, and commanded the attention of a respectable audience for upwards of two hours, at the close a vote of thanks was proposed and carried nem. con. and another lecture was announced for Wednesday evening, the 19th inst., in the same room, by the Rev. Joseph Ketley, of Farnham, on ‟Alfred the great.”
